PBHV9115Z,115 Description

Short technical summary and product information.

The Nexperia PBHV9115Z,115 is a PNP bipolar junction transistor designed for high-voltage applications. It features a low collector-emitter saturation voltage (VCEsat) and high collector current capability.

 

Key electrical specifications include a collector-emitter voltage (VCEO) of 150V and a continuous collector current (IC) of 1A. The DC current gain (hFE) is a minimum of 100 at 100mA and 10V. The transistor can dissipate up to 1.4W of power at 25°C ambient temperature.

 

This device is housed in a SOT-223 (SC-73) medium power surface-mounted device (SMD) plastic package. Its high voltage capability and low saturation voltage make it suitable for applications such as LED drivers for LED chain modules, LCD backlighting, and high-intensity discharge (HID) front lighting.

 

Additional features include a frequency rating of 115MHz and a junction temperature up to 150°C. The NPN complement is PBHV8115Z.

PBHV9115Z,115 FAQs

6 frequently asked questions generated from this part’s specifications.
What is the maximum collector-emitter voltage (Vceo) for the PBHV9115Z,115?

The maximum collector-emitter voltage (Vceo) for the PBHV9115Z,115 is -150 V.

What is the maximum continuous collector current (Ic) for the PBHV9115Z,115?

The maximum continuous collector current (Ic) for the PBHV9115Z,115 is -1 A.

What is the DC current gain (hFE) of the PBHV9115Z,115 at 25°C?

The DC current gain (hFE) of the PBHV9115Z,115 is a minimum of 100 and a typical of 220 at VCE = -10 V and IC = -50 mA.

What is the maximum power dissipation for the PBHV9115Z,115?

The maximum power dissipation (Ptot) for the PBHV9115Z,115 is 1.4 W at 25°C ambient temperature (device mounted on an FR4 PCB with mounting pad for collector 6 cm2).

What is the operating temperature range for the PBHV9115Z,115?

The operating junction temperature (Tj) for the PBHV9115Z,115 can reach up to 150°C.

What package type is the PBHV9115Z,115 supplied in?

The PBHV9115Z,115 is supplied in a SOT-223 surface mount package.
